Output fa3c3cfd56a3935ea2a4540c52336fc2cb30105012f004e78996e3061ddcf489:4

value
95728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adaab7fd9c3cb0a63439e7db3df79e5f23a525f3 OP_EQUAL
address
3HXHLUUkYQXQMhYk2pwEGLQic5xybSkcFu
transaction
fa3c3cfd56a3935ea2a4540c52336fc2cb30105012f004e78996e3061ddcf489
confirmations
138829
spent
true